ONVIF Hosts 2015 Member Meeting

The company provided an update on activities and accomplishments over the years

ONVIF hosted its annual membership meetings and elections, where the company provided an update on activities and accomplishments over the past year. Some items that were discussed include the development and publication of two new profiles, the launch of a false conformance reporting tool on the ONVIF website and the organization’s ongoing membership and growth in conformant products.

ONVIF Steering Committee Chairman Per Björrkdahl discussed the company’s growing acceptance in the industry.

“ONVIF has made incredible strides since our formation in 2008,” Björkdahl said. “Together, we have developed five profiles, offered education and networking opportunities to thousands of people and have gained broad acceptance within the physical security industry. Above all, we a member-driven group, so we thank all of our members for their hard work and dedication,” said Björkdahl.

Mayur Salgar of Honeywell was named to the Steering Committee, as well as Kim Loy of Pelco by Schneider Electronic.
